What is a rogue character?
A rogue is a versatile character, capable of sneaky combat and nimble tricks. The rogue also has the ability to “sneak attack” (“backstab” in previous editions) enemies who are caught off-guard or taken by surprise, inflicting extra damage.

Can a thief be a wizard in DND 5e?
There are multiple ways to make a Wizard/Thief within a single class in DND 5e. One is the Arcane Trickster which is a Thief/Wizard, a subclass choice for the Rogue class. Another option is any magic casting class with a Criminal, Charlatan, Street Urchin or Spy background.
What do you need to know about classes in Wizardry?
Classes in the game represent typical archetypes of fantasy literature or role-playing games. Each class has a specific set of statistic requirements (equivalent to the ” stats ” or ” ability scores ” of other similar games), which must be met to be eligible for said class.
